simSchool - About - 1 views

  • simSchool is a classroom simulation that supports the rapid accumulation of a teacher's experience in analyzing student differences, adapting instruction to individual learner needs, gathering data about the impacts of instruction, and seeing the results of their teaching.
  • improvement in general teaching skill improved confidence in using technology increased belief that the teacher has the skills and ability to make a difference in a child's life improvement in pre-service teachers' performance in teacher preparation courses and attitudes toward inclusion of special needs students significant positive impact on the mastery of deeper learning capacities that comprise the readiness to teach increased "staying power" on the path to the field of teaching acquired through rapid development of strong self-efficacy and resilience
  •  
    simSchool is a simulated classroom that supports rapid accumulation of a teacher's experience in analyzing student differences, adapting instruction to individual learning needs, gathering data about the impacts of instruction, and seeing the results of their teaching. This is a place where instructors can explore instructional strategies, examine classroom management techniques, and practice building relationships with students that will translate into increased learning. elearnspace › Learning Analytics 2011: Reflections - 0 views

  • 1. Analytics will be huge in education and are coming faster than almost anyone can anticipate. 2. Analytics are growing in prominence in many different disciplines and from all parts of the education system. Researchers from different fields found shared space in the analytics discussion. Are analytics the “universal decoder” for education reform? 3. Ethics are going to be an enormous concern. We all acknowledged it. No clear way forward exists at this stage. 4. Analytics can be applied across the full spectrum of education: for teachers, learners, administrators, policy makers, and government officials. 5. Student success, based partly in adaptive and personal learning, is a substantial motivator for foundations, administrators, and politicians. Under various covers (college completion, accountability, increased institutional effectiveness) analytics will be appropriated to serve numerous ideals, causes, and visions. 6. Brace yourself for the usual hype cycle: analytics will be everything, they will cure all ails, they will transform education, they will [_____]. Purchase your Batman Consultant-Repellant spray now.

What Can We Learn About Assessment From Video Games? | edte.ch - 0 views

  • The types of “dynamic and ongoing feedback” that help a player improve at the point of learning - the summary sheets help us to reflect on how we scored but this is the same as what grade did I get
  • Not just seeing the individual method of feedback in isolation but placing it within the whole picture, the whole plan for supporting new players and helping them to be successful.
  • Unfortunately points scoring and rewards are in the short term ‘easy’ ways for teachers to motivate pupils to do what the are told. Look at the number of ‘team points’ and ‘star charts’ that exist in primary schools. This may get them to behave in the required way, but it teaches pupils that only things that are worth doing are things that get them a number score…
